Seed Optimization with Frozen Generator for Superior Zero-shot Low-light Enhancement

no code implementations15 Feb 2024 Yuxuan Gu, Yi Jin, Ben Wang, Zhixiang Wei, Xiaoxiao Ma, Pengyang Ling, Haoxuan Wang, Huaian Chen, Enhong Chen

In this work, we observe that the generators, which are pre-trained on massive natural images, inherently hold the promising potential for superior low-light image enhancement against varying scenarios. Specifically, we embed a pre-trained generator to Retinex model to produce reflectance maps with enhanced detail and vividness, thereby recovering features degraded by low-light conditions. Taking one step further, we introduce a novel optimization strategy, which backpropagates the gradients to the input seeds rather than the parameters of the low-light enhancement model, thus intactly retaining the generative knowledge learned from natural images and achieving faster convergence speed.
